Stock Photo - 30 August 2019, Mexico, Tapachula: Sculptures of a female coyote and her puppy stand in the southern Mexican city of Tapachula, near the border with Guatemala. Activists set them up there at the end of August. They represent migrant mothers and their children. On the sculpture of the female, the route to the USA is drawn for migrants. Tapachula is on the way of many migrants who want to go from Central America to the USA.
